About The Position

As a Technical Writer on the Manufacturing Engineering team, you will help elevate documentation to a core discipline within manufacturing engineering. You'll work cross-functionally to research processes, gather complex technical details, and produce clear, precise, and accessible documentation that supports production excellence. Your expertise will improve operations, enhance standardization, and ensure long-term knowledge retention across the organization. You will report directly to the Production Manager of Cap Manufacturing at our Everett, WA facility.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ent work experience
  • 3+ years of experience authoring technical content within a manufacturing environment
  • Experience translating complex technical information into concise, and applicable documentation for production teams
  • Advanced writing, editing, and proofreading skills with attention to technical accuracy and clarity
  • Proficiency in documentation tools and systems such as Microsoft Office, Confluence, SharePoint, or equivalent platforms
  • Familiarity with electrical/mechanical component production processes
  • Experience supporting new product introduction (NPI) documentation within an engineering or production setting
  • Experience with tool development, lifecycle activities, tools and processes

Responsibilities

  • Author comprehensive work instructions used by production manufacturing and test operations in a high-complexity manufacturing environment
  • Collaborate with engineers and technicians to refine build sequences, process flow, and tool documentation for improved efficiency
  • Lead the creation and release of documentation for new product lines in partnership with design and manufacturing engineering
  • Develop Job Hazard Assessments, safety procedures, and department-wide specifications to meet compliance standards
  • Build standardized documentation templates and work instruction formats for capacitor manufacturing
  • Establish standardization rules, best practices, and style guidelines for technical documentation
  • Manage documentation systems, including PDMs, SDS databases, folder structures, and accessibility within MES systems
  • Mentor and provide guidance to junior writers and engineers contributing to documentation
  • Improve documentation practices and support strategic plans within Manufacturing Engineering
  • Manage a system for continuous improvement for documentation, managing multiple projects at once
